How to conjugate despedazar in Indicative Informal Future in Spanish

despedazar
to tear apart, to dismember, to shred
regular verb

Despedazar means to tear or break something into pieces, often violently or destructively. It is used both literally, for physical destruction, and figuratively, for breaking something into parts or fragments.
